CS8957/8957H单周期8051微控制器:64KB Flash ROM与高级特性概览

需积分: 5 0 下载量 85 浏览量 更新于2024-07-09 收藏 679KB PDF 举报
CS8957/8957H是一款由Myson Century, Inc.生产的高级8位微控制器,它集成了单周期8051 CPU内核、64KB Flash ROM、256字节内部RAM以及768字节辅助RAM。这款微控制器具有丰富的外围功能,包括9通道通用脉冲宽度调制(PWM)输出端口和10通道12位模数转换器(ADC),使得它在工业控制和信号处理应用中具有广泛的应用潜力。 其核心特性如下: 1. **单周期8051 CPU核心**:CS8957/8957H采用单周期8051 CPU架构,这意味着执行指令的速度非常快,最高工作频率可达20MHz,提高了系统的响应速度和效率。 2. **电源兼容性**:该微控制器支持两种供电选项,即单+5V电源(CS8957H型号)和+3.3V电源(CS8957型号),这使得它能够在多种电源环境下稳定工作。 3. **嵌入式存储**: - 内部Flash ROM:64KB的闪存内存用于存储程序代码,提供足够的空间来实现复杂的功能和系统配置。 - RAM结构:包括1024字节的RAM和细分的内部资源,包括256字节常规RAM用于一般数据处理,以及768字节辅助RAM,可用来扩展程序执行空间或存储临时数据。 4. **编程灵活性**:内置Boot-Code-Free ISP功能允许用户通过I²C接口或UART进行在系统编程(ISP),方便代码升级和维护,无需外部烧录设备。 5. **外设扩展**:通过适当的寄存器设置,微控制器可以访问外部64KB的数据存储器,增强了存储资源的灵活性,能够连接更大的数据存储设备以满足特定应用需求。 这款微控制器的设计旨在为用户提供高性能、低功耗和灵活的解决方案,适用于对速度、存储容量和易用性有较高要求的工业自动化和控制系统。无论是作为核心控制单元还是外围扩展设备,CS8957/8957H都能有效地提升整体系统的性能和可靠性。